PulseView  unreleased development snapshot
A Qt-based sigrok GUI
pv::views::trace::CursorPair Member List

This is the complete list of members for pv::views::trace::CursorPair, including all inherited members.

context_parent_pv::views::trace::ViewItemprotected
create_header_context_menu(QWidget *parent) overridepv::views::trace::CursorPairvirtual
create_popup(QWidget *parent) overridepv::views::trace::CursorPairvirtual
create_view_context_menu(QWidget *parent, QPoint &click_pos)pv::views::trace::ViewItemvirtual
CursorPair(View &view)pv::views::trace::CursorPair
delete_pressed()pv::views::trace::ViewItemvirtual
delta(const pv::util::Timestamp &other) const overridepv::views::trace::CursorPairvirtual
DeltaPaddingpv::views::trace::CursorPairprivatestatic
drag()pv::views::trace::ViewItem
drag_by(const QPoint &delta)pv::views::trace::TimeItemvirtual
drag_point(const QRect &rect) const overridepv::views::trace::CursorPairvirtual
drag_point_pv::views::trace::ViewItemprotected
drag_release()pv::views::trace::ViewItemvirtual
dragging() const pv::views::trace::ViewItem
enabled() const overridepv::views::trace::CursorPairvirtual
fill_color_pv::views::trace::CursorPairprivate
first() const pv::views::trace::CursorPair
first_pv::views::trace::CursorPairprivate
format_string(int max_width=0, std::function< double(const QString &)> query_size=[](const QString &s) -> double{(void) s;return 0;})pv::views::trace::CursorPair
format_string_sub(int time_precision, int freq_precision, bool show_unit=true)pv::views::trace::CursorPairprivate
get_cursor_offsets() const pv::views::trace::CursorPair
get_x() const overridepv::views::trace::CursorPairvirtual
highlight_pen()pv::views::trace::ViewItemprotectedstatic
HighlightRadiuspv::views::trace::ViewItemstatic
hit_box_rect(const ViewItemPaintParams &pp) const pv::views::trace::ViewItemvirtual
hover_point_changed(const QPoint &hp)pv::views::trace::ViewItemvirtual
is_draggable(QPoint pos) const pv::views::trace::ViewItemvirtual
is_selectable(QPoint pos) const pv::views::trace::ViewItemvirtual
is_snapping_disabled() const pv::views::trace::TimeItem
label_area_pv::views::trace::CursorPairprivate
label_incomplete_pv::views::trace::CursorPairprivate
label_rect(const QRectF &rect) const overridepv::views::trace::CursorPairvirtual
LabelPaddingpv::views::trace::ViewItemstatic
mouse_left_press_event(const QMouseEvent *event)pv::views::trace::ViewItemvirtual
on_hover_point_changed(const QWidget *widget, const QPoint &hp)pv::views::trace::CursorPairslot
on_setting_changed(const QString &key, const QVariant &value) overridepv::views::trace::CursorPairvirtual
paint_back(QPainter &p, ViewItemPaintParams &pp) overridepv::views::trace::CursorPairvirtual
paint_fore(QPainter &p, ViewItemPaintParams &pp)pv::views::trace::ViewItemvirtual
paint_label(QPainter &p, const QRect &rect, bool hover) overridepv::views::trace::CursorPairvirtual
paint_mid(QPainter &p, ViewItemPaintParams &pp)pv::views::trace::ViewItemvirtual
second() const pv::views::trace::CursorPair
second_pv::views::trace::CursorPairprivate
select(bool select=true)pv::views::trace::ViewItemvirtual
select_text_color(QColor background)pv::views::trace::ViewItemstatic
selected() const pv::views::trace::ViewItem
set_time(const pv::util::Timestamp &time) overridepv::views::trace::CursorPairvirtual
show_frequency_pv::views::trace::CursorPairprivate
show_interval_pv::views::trace::CursorPairprivate
show_samples_pv::views::trace::CursorPairprivate
snapping_disabled_pv::views::trace::TimeItemprotected
text_size_pv::views::trace::CursorPairprivate
time() const overridepv::views::trace::CursorPairvirtual
TimeItem(View &view)pv::views::trace::TimeItemprotected
view_pv::views::trace::TimeItemprotected
ViewItem()pv::views::trace::ViewItem
~CursorPair()pv::views::trace::CursorPair